Louisville city, Georgia Household Income Distribution in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on October 30, 2023.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, among the 882 of Louisville city, GA households, there were 32 households (3.63%) that had a household income that fell in the $200K - and Over category, and there were 6 households (0.68%) that had a household income that fell in the $150K - Less $200K category.

On the other hand, there were 492 households (55.78%) that had a household income that fell in the Less $40K category, and there were 87 households (9.86%) that had a household income that fell in the $40K - Less $50K category.

Louisville city, GA Household Income Distribution in 2021

Household Income Categories Number of Households Percentage of Households (%)
Less $10K 155 17.57
$10K - Less $15K 108 12.25
$15K - Less $20K 33 3.74
$20K - Less $25K 49 5.56
$25K - Less $30K 76 8.62
$30K - Less $35K 46 5.22
$35K - Less $40K 25 2.83
$40K - Less $45K 87 9.86
$50K - Less $60K 31 3.52
$60K - Less $75K 52 5.90
$75K - Less $100K 93 10.54
$100K - Less $125K 68 7.71
$125K - Less $150K 21 2.38
$150K - Less $200K 6 0.68
$200K - and Over 32 3.63
